Abstract :
The elements in the eco-geochemical environment have the close relationship with human´s health. In this paper, take the iodine as an example, based on the data of eco-geochemical investigation at the lower Yellow River in Shandong Province, the distribution of iodine in eco-geochemical environment of Yuncheng is summarized. The relationship between endemic goiter and iodine in environment is studied from the respect of relief soils and potable water. It suggests that endemic goiter has high positive correlation with iodine content in water and it has no correlation with iodine content in soils. The results can provide qualitative basis for the prevention and control of the endemic goiter, and have positive significance for economic and social development.
